Описание тега isomorphic-git

Isomorphic-git - это чистая реализация git на JavaScript для узлов и браузеров.
0 ответов

Не удалось скомпилировать проект узла с использованием библиотеки js isomorphic-git

Я создал новый проект node.js, используя "create-реагировать-приложение". Он работал нормально, пока я не ввел новую js-зависимость "isomorphic-git@0.35.1". Теперь проект не может быть скомпилирован со следующим сообщением об ошибке. ./node_modules/…
09 окт '18 в 06:37
0 ответов

Дугит / изоморфный мерзавец в электроне за прокси

Я пишу электронное приложение, которое время от времени должно клонировать и извлекать репозитории, и оно работает хорошо. Тем не менее, он не работает за корпоративным аутентифицированным (базовым или дайджест) прокси. Как я понимаю, электрон может…
25 июн '18 в 18:09
2 ответа

Как запустить изолированную среду Node.js внутри браузера?

Я пытаюсь использовать изоморфный мерзавец для выполнения git clone команда на стороне браузера. Но из-за того, что я придерживаюсь политики одного и того же происхождения, я не могу отправить запрос к другому источнику в GitLab нашей компании, если…
20 авг '19 в 05:53
1 ответ

Как читать файлы, клонированные с помощью isomorphic-git на стороне браузера?

Я выполнил git clone команда с isomorphic-git на стороне браузера. Но я не знаю, где эти файлы хранятся и как читать эти файлы с помощью JavaScript. Фрагмент кода: import { configure } from 'browserfs' import { plugins, clone } from 'isomorphic-git'…
16 авг '19 в 06:01
1 ответ

Как удалить / добавить на сцену файл, который удален / не отслеживается из-за переименования папки

Пример использования Скопируйте папку вместе с файлами, используя fs.copyFile путем перебора путей к файлам в папке. Удалите файлы в папке, скопированные с помощью fs.unlinkSync Удалите теперь удаленные файлы из индекса git, используя git.remove Доб…
04 окт '19 в 09:01
0 ответов

isomorphic-git, инициализирующий репо, делает локальное репо поврежденным

У меня очень странная проблема. Я создал максимально простую репродукцию номера. package.json { "scripts": { "start": "node index.js" }, "dependencies": { "isomorphic-git": "^1.3.1", "rimraf": "^3.0.2" } } index.js const fs = require("fs"), git = re…
1 ответ

git.push() работает, но фиксация на github пуста

Я использую isomorphic-git в браузере (на данный момент Chrome), чтобы попытаться сохранить код на github После клонирования частного репозитория github я пытаюсь добавить в него новые файлы, выполнить фиксацию и отправить его обратно в тот же частн…
1 ответ

isomorphic-git clone() TypeError: невозможно прочитать свойство bind неопределенного значения

Я хотел бы использовать isomorphic-git с BrowserFS на Kintone (который не поддерживает импорт модулей). Я не контролирую теги скрипта, но вот как они включаются в результирующую страницу: <script src="https://unpkg.com/isomorphic-git@1.7.4&q…
03 авг '20 в 05:42
0 ответов

Есть ли способ выполнить разреженную проверку или частичное клонирование с помощью изоморфного git или аналогичного пакета javascript?

Я просмотрел как изоморфный git, так и node-git, пытаясь найти способ выполнить разреженную проверку, однако ни один из пакетов, похоже, не позволяет вам это сделать. Возможно, так как разреженная проверка не включена в libgit2?
11 авг '20 в 13:29
0 ответов

изоморфный git push to github ошибка аутентификации: ECONNRESET

Я сделал толчок после api let pushResult = await git.push({ fs, http, dir: '/tutorial', remote: 'origin', ref: 'main', onAuth: () => ({ username: process.env.GITHUB_TOKEN }), }) Но подождав некоторое время, я получил ошибку: {"errno":-4077,"code"…
07 авг '21 в 09:19
0 ответов

isomorphic-git , Как следует использовать сетевые прокси

Мне часто попадаются Read ECONNRESET и 502 Badway Как следует использовать сетевые прокси на isomorphic-git
16 фев '22 в 06:58
0 ответов

Получить информацию о теге, используя имя тега

Я использую isomorphic-git для проекта, и мне нужно прочитать информацию об аннотированном теге git. Мой текущий код в настоящее время выглядит примерно так: import * as git from 'isomorphic-git'; import * as fs from 'fs'; import * as http from 'htt…
08 фев '23 в 01:22
0 ответов

Как получить список измененных файлов с помощью isomorphic-git?

git statusможет отображать все измененные файлы в текущей папке. Но путь к файлу требуется сisomorphic-gitкоманда состояния. Как я могу получить список измененных файлов с помощью isomorphic-git? Спасибо.
20 июн '22 в 09:18
1 ответ

git clone завершается с ошибкой: connect ECONNREFUSED 127.0.0.1:80

Я использую isomorphic-git для проекта, и при попытке использоватьgit.cloneя получаю ошибкуError: connect ECONNREFUSED 127.0.0.1:80. Это простое воспроизведение того, что я пытаюсь сделать: import * as git from 'isomorphic-git'; import * as fs from …
08 фев '23 в 12:44